Introduction

Alcohol cleansing is a vital process in trip of recovery for individuals fighting alcohol addiction. It aims to expel toxins from the human body while managing detachment symptoms. This report explores the value of liquor detoxification, signs and symptoms experienced during cleansing, together with methods used assuring a secure and effective detoxification procedure.

Significance of Alcohol Detox

Alcoholic beverages detox plays a crucial role in addiction data recovery as a result of real and psychological reliance that develops in the long run. Persistent alcoholic abuse contributes to changes in brain biochemistry, leading to withdrawal symptoms when alcohol consumption is ceased. These symptoms range from tremors, anxiety, insomnia, nausea, as well as seizures. By undergoing detox, individuals can conquer the immediate real aftereffects of alcoholic beverages withdrawal, setting the phase for further therapy and long-lasting data recovery.

Signs Experienced During Alcohol Detoxification

During liquor cleansing, individuals can experience many detachment symptoms that can differ in severity. Mild symptoms may include shaking, perspiring, and problems, while more serious cases can involve hallucinations, delirium, and seizures. The strength and extent of these signs rely on different facets, such as the quantity and timeframe of alcohol abuse, individual health conditions, and previous cleansing experiences. It is critical to remember that these symptoms could be deadly, highlighting the need of medical direction during the cleansing procedure.

Outpatient detox programs provide freedom, allowing individuals to get therapy while living at home. However, they have been generally recommended for people who have mild detachment signs and a very good support system. Inpatient cleansing programs offer a controlled environment with 24/7 health care, ensuring immediate focus on any complications which could arise. Hospital-based detox, having said that, is suitable for individuals with severe withdrawal symptoms, needing a greater amount of health intervention.

During detoxification, healthcare professionals may administer medicines to alleviate detachment signs and reduce discomfort. Medicines eg benzodiazepines, anticonvulsants, and anti-anxiety medications can be familiar with handle withdrawal symptoms effortlessly. In addition, doctors monitor essential indications, offer guidance services, and implement a thorough plan for treatment to address the underlying factors behind alcoholic beverages addiction.
